Lighting Effects on Older Adults’ Visual and Nonvisual Performance: A Systematic Review

Abstract Lighting plays an important role in daily life: It helps people perform daily activities independently and safely, and also benefits their health. This study assesses the research evidence of lighting’s impacts on older adults in four domains: (a) performance of activities of daily living and instrumental activities of daily living; (b) circadian rhythm; (c) fall prevention and postural stability; and (d) sleep quality. A comprehensive review of lighting studies on older adults’ visual and nonvisual performance was conducted using a modified PRISMA systematic review process. For the first domain, some older adults had difficulty in using the toilet, preparing meals, and doing laundry under lower illuminance. For the second domain, brighter and bluish lighting improved older adults’ circadian rhythm. For the third domain, low-intensity LED lighting affixed on door frames can help older adults maintain postural stability and prevent falling during nighttime movement. Finally, some studies concluded that receiving outdoor daylight during exercise was beneficial to older adults’ sleep quality. This study provides several methodological, theoretical, and collaborative suggestions for developing a more conclusive evidence base for lighting standards and strategies for older adults.

照明对老年人视觉和非视觉表现的影响:系统评价

摘要 照明在日常生活中扮演着重要的角色:它帮助人们独立、安全地进行日常活动,也有益于他们的健康。本研究从四个方面评估了照明对老年人影响的研究证据:(a) 日常生活活动和日常生活中的工具性活动;(b) 昼夜节律;(c) 防止跌倒和姿势稳定;(d) 睡眠质量。使用修改后的 PRISMA 系统审查程序对老年人视觉和非视觉表现的照明研究进行了全面审查。对于第一域,一些老年人在较低照度下难以如厕、做饭和洗衣服。对于第二个领域,更亮和更蓝的照明改善了老年人的昼夜节律。对于第三个域,贴在门框上的低强度 LED 灯可以帮助老年人保持姿势稳定并防止夜间运动时跌倒。最后,一些研究得出结论,在运动期间接受户外日光有益于老年人的睡眠质量。本研究提供了几种方法论、理论和协作建议,以开发更确定性的老年人照明标准和策略的证据基础。
